Some of my fellow followers on Twitter a few days back were requesting people contribute with any tips or helpful hints to get the most out of BarCampMiami and FOWA next week. I managed to get a few tips together (mostly reminders). If you want to add any, please leave a comment. Thanks!
1. Social Events - Get the most out of the experience by attending these (some require tickets to be purchased ASAP):
UPDATE: Unofficial FOWA Beer Lovers Meetup
Geek Dinner - Sunday, February 22, 2009 from 7:00 PM - 9:30 PM (ET)
Social Media Club South Florida Meetup - Feb. 23rd 6:30pm to 9pm
FOWA After Party - Feb. 24th at Nikki Beach Club
2. Bring lots of business cards. Exchange of cards seems to be still a time honored part of a meet/greet.
3. At FOWA, there are going to be FREE uni sessions - mini conferences in “break out rooms”. 50 spaces per session, first come first served. Facebook, Sun, etc.
4. Obvious, but if you don’t have extra iphone, laptop, or batteries start ordering them (or actually buying them locally) now. Don’t count on outlets although FOWA says there will be placed to “plug in your laptop”.
5. At FOWA, according to sources, wireless internet will be in the lobby ONLY. Should be able to get a 3G signal inside though. At BarCamp, there is Wifi in the restaurant but when I spoke to @alexdc, he was thinking it might be limited to due demand.
6. UPDATE: Follow the FriendFeed Room FOWA Miami & WordCamp/BarCamp/NewsInnovation. It monitors tweets and flickr feeds in one easy place. There’s also a RSS feed of the room in case you can’t follow FriendFeed directly.
